We have a pretty simple REST API; you send us queries via HTTP or HTTPS with the parameters as GET data, and we send back a document containing the results in one of three formats:

  • JSON (default)
  • XML
  • CSV

Since it's just HTTP, it's platform independent, and you can do test queries via a standard Internet browser.

Documentation for API version 3.0 can be accessed from the Support drop-down menu on the main page of our website, or from the Support menu in your account.

.

Our API does support CURL.
An example CURL call from a linux command line would look like this:

curl "api.data24-7.com/textat.php?username=YOUR_USERNAME&password=YOUR_PASSWORD&p1=PHONENUM"

It's important to remember the quotes!

If you input a USA or Canadian phone number to Carrier247(Carrier Type), it will return the type of phone it is:

  • L=Landline
  • M=Mobile
  • V=VOIP

If you input a phone number to Text@, Carrier247(USA), or Carrier247(International), it will return:

  • the carrier's name
  • the type of phone it is

Carrier247(USA) works for USA and Canadian numbers. Carrier 247(USA) has number portability awareness for USA numbers, that means that when someone ports their phone number from one carrier to another, we know about it almost immediately, and we guarantee that our records will be updated within one business day, although they usually will be updated within an hour.

Unfortunately, due to regulations in Canada, we cannot provide local number portability data for Canadian phone numbers to customers unless they get approval from the Canadian Local Number Portability Consortium (CLNPC).

For Carrier247(USA), if the phone is wireless, it will also return:

  • the SMS Gateway Address
  • the MMS Gateway Address

The SMS and MMS Gateway Addresses can be used to send text messages and picture messages to wireless phones. The Gateway Addresses are email addresses of the carrier. To send a text to the recipient, you send an email message to the carrier using the Gateway Email Address, and the carrier sends your message to the recipient as an SMS or MMS message.

NOTE: Text@ and Carrier247(USA) are identical in function and price.

The Gateway Addresses are not available for Carrier247(International) since most international carriers don't provide them.

If the phone is wireless, it will also return the last date when the phone was ported from the last carrier to the current carrier. This information is currently automatically returned for Manual lookups only. For API lookups, it requires a specific option in the API call. It is an optional field for File Uploads.

In order to sign up for our Do-Not-Call service, you will need to open up an account with us and then go to https://telemarketing.donotcall.gov, the FTC's National Do-Not-Call Registry, and register with them.

After you have registered with the FTC, you will need to specify the Area Codes that you will be calling. The first five Area Codes are free; after that, the FTC will charge you for each Area Code.

Once you have selected your Area Codes, you will be assigned an Organization ID and a Subscription Account Number (SAN). You will need to give us both of these numbers in order for us to allow you to legally access our Do-Not-Call Service. You can open a Help Desk ticket on our website and send us those two pieces of information. We will update your account and notify you that you are good to go.

Do-Not-Call (USA) helps you to stay compliant with USA Federal Do-Not-Call laws. We help you maintain your own internal DNC list, and help you avoid calling phone numbers which could cause Federal violations and serious penalties.

Our Do-Not-Call data is updated weekly from the USA Federal Government, and we can track your organization's internal Do-Not-Call list as well.

Do-Not-Call (USA) returns the following information for the phone numbers that you supply:

  • Phone Number
  • DNC status

The per-lookup charge for the Do-Not-Call (USA) service is $0.002 (1/5 penny).
